Do you put Moroccan oil on wet or dry hair?

Apply 1–2 pumps of Moroccanoil® Treatment to clean, towel-dried hair, from mid-length to ends. Blow-dry or let dry naturally. Apply on dry hair to tame flyaways, condition split ends and smooth hair.

What is Moroccan oil?

Moroccan oil is Argan oil . The oil is pressed from the kernels of the Argan tree’s fruit. This particular tree only grows in Morocco, which is how the oil is given its name. Because the Argan tree only grows in one small area, the price of this oil is relatively high compared to other oils used on hair. The oil is a light amber color ...

Is Moroccan oil good for hair?

Moroccan oil is chock-full of hair-helping benefits. It gets its moisturizing properties from its high levels of fatty acids, mostly made up of oleic and linoleic acids. It also has a lot of vitamin E and naturally-occurring antioxidants that can help battle free radicals.

How to apply a curl treatment?

Apply mostly from hair’s mid-length to ends. Don’t brush through your curls; apply the treatment in a crunching motion with your fingers to avoid breaking up the curls . The less you touch or run your fingers through your hair, the better.
